Why Painting Costs Vary So Much
Two homes can look similar from the outside and still have completely different project costs. That’s because pricing depends less on the idea of “painting” and more on the details behind it.
This is the starting point.
More square footage means more surface area, more prep, and more time. But layout matters just as much.
Vaulted ceilings, multi-story exteriors, and detailed trim all add complexity that affects the overall scope.

Not all paint jobs are built the same.
Higher-quality materials and proper application take more time, but they also last longer and look better over time. A faster, cheaper job might look fine at first, but it often needs to be redone sooner.
